Grasping Binary Addition and Subtraction Made Simple
Binary arithmetic operates on a system of just two digits: 0 and 1. Addition in binary is simple. When you add two binary numbers, you examine each place value, starting from the rightmost digit. If the sum of the digits in a particular place value is zero|one|1, the result for that place value is also 0|one|1. If the sum is two, you write down 0 and carry over 1 to the next place value. Subtraction in binary follows a similar method.
